Update: Horry County police find missing Myrtle Beach man

Horry County police, who had been searching for a 23-year-old Myrtle Beach man who suffers from schizophrenia, said he was found on Tuesday.

His family reported Sawyer Michael Morgan of Pampas Drive in Myrtle Beach missing on Thursday, according to police reports. He was found around 2:30 p.m. Tuesday, according to Lt. Raul Denis with Horry County police.

Details on his whereabouts were not released.
